A Chicken-Orange Soup with Parsnip Recipe
Chicken is justifiably one of the best loved meats in the world.
It is very lean, high in protein, highly versatile and is the key ingredient in many weight loss recipes.
For many people, the archetypal nostalgia food is chicken soup. Chicken soup is a useful meal and is frequently served to people who are in poor health, but it is just as valuable for weight watchers.
Here is a specially appetizing chicken soup recipe with a surprise ingredient for you to cook at home.
Before we commence, a few comments on purchasing the chicken.
If you are able to buy an free range chicken, do so, as it will be less likely to be contaminated with additives and hormones. It's also a sound policy from an humanitarian point of view, as some of the chickens sold in supermarkets are forced to live in conditions that are absolutely terrible.
On to the recipe.
It requires:
2 fresh oranges (juice only)
1 finely ground pepper (black
2 onions (chopped and peeled)
3 tablespoons of olive oil
750 ml of chicken stock
10 cloves of garlic (halved)
8 parsnips (either fresh or pre-roasted)
1 teaspoon of salt
Technique:
Heat oil in a pan. Place onions and cook until soft. Let 10 minutes pass and then place garlic cloves and the roasted parsnips. Leave some of the parsnips to be added later.
Fry vegetables until they are soft for 10 to 15 minutes. Stir occasionally while adding the parsnips (should be pre-roasted).
Pour the chicken stock into the vegetable mix. Put in some black pepper and salt. Allow to simmer up to 20 minutes. Liquidize this after.
To enhance taste, add seasoning and orange juice.
This dish serves 6 people as a first course, but you may choose to serve it as a meal in itself with wholemeal bread, in which case it serves four people easily.
